About
Glenn Dubin is an investor and philanthropist. He is the Founder and Principal of Dubin & Co. LP, a private investment firm, as well as the Chairman of the Dubin Family Foundation. Glenn focuses on investments in early and late-stage growth companies, where he provides strategic advice and mentorship to their founders. Glenn is also a co-Founder, Board member and former Board chair of the Robin Hood Foundation, which pioneered the application of investment principles to charitable giving. Established in 1988, Robin Hood is now the largest poverty-fighting organization in New York City, having invested more than $3 billion dollars in over 425 community partners. In 1992, Glenn co-founded Highbridge Capital Management LLC, an alternative asset management company that grew to over $35 billion of capital under management under his tenure.
